Southeastern Roommate FAQs

Question: How important is communication when choosing a roommate at Southeastern University? Communication is crucial when selecting a roommate at Southeastern University. Clear communication about your expectations, needs, and boundaries can help ensure a successful living experience during your time at the university. Question: What are some red flags to look out for when searching for a roommate at Southeastern University? When selecting a roommate at Southeastern University, it's essential to watch out for signs that they may not be a good match for you. Some red flags to be aware of include poor hygiene, a tendency to party frequently, or an unwillingness to compromise and share responsibilities. Question: How can I determine if a potential roommate at Southeastern University is financially responsible and reliable? One way to vet a potential roommate's financial responsibility is by asking for references from previous roommates or landlords. You can also have an honest conversation about finances, including bills and rent. At Southeastern University, it's also important to make sure that your potential roommate can provide proof of financial aid or other resources to contribute to housing costs.
